Exporting HDV Problems
Hi guys,
I’m trying to export a 20 second clip of HDV footage that I imported into Adobe Premiere Elements 4. I think I’ve exported the file 80 different ways in 15 different formats over the past few days and I can’t get it to come out looking like it should.
The framesize of the file is (I think) 1440×1080. When I export it using quicktime h264 codec (or anything else for that matter) at the 1440×1080 framesize with the default HD Anamorphic 1080 (1.33) pixel aspect ratio it comes out playing fine but it is squeezed horizontally. So to avoid the squeeze I tried exporting at 1920×1080 with square pixel aspect ratio. Then it comes out looking great but it lags a lot and won’t play smoothly. Sometimes freezing altogether
My computer is an HP Athlon x2 dual core processer 5600+ 2.80Ghz with 3gb ram system running Vista. I don’t think it should be lagging these files (correct me if I’m wrong!).Additional things I’ve tried are interpreting footage at different pixel ratios (ended up squeezed still), and I’ve tried exporting varios AVIs but no luck.
If the original file is 1440×1080 then why is it exporting squeezed when I use that setting? Please help! What should I do?
